Last week the Government announced additional funding of £6.5 million for the Canal & River Trust, to support repair, maintenance and long-term projects.

This is welcome, but nowhere near enough to stop the decline of the canal network – which has become very obvious through the media coverage of the breach on the Llangollen Canal before Christmas. And it only helps the 2,000 miles of waterways managed by the Canal & River Trust, and does nothing for the other 3,000 miles.

But – and it is a big ‘but’ – it does show that the Government is starting to take notice and realise the predicament of our inland waterways. It is the second announcement of additional funding in the last six months, after the Cambridgeshire & Peterborough Combined Authority contributed £500,000 for repairs to locks on the River Cam.

The Fund Britain’s Waterways message is starting to be heard. This is the time to keep pushing, to show government how much our waterways matter.
